New Da Capo anime might bring sexy back
by Tim Sheehy, 11/01/2009
New Da Capo anime might bring sexy back photo

It's been about 4 years since the last season of D.C. ~Da Capo~ aired on Chiba TV, but it looks as though another season might be hitting the air sometime next year. Reportedly, Circus--a studio famous for their countless eroge filled with horny school girls that may or may not choose to partake in sexy fun-time with you, depending on your choice of dialog--recently dropped the news at their Premium Concert and  Announcement event over the weekend. 

The original Da Capo eroge centered around a boy named Junichi  and takes place during the end of his middle school days.  They throw in some pointless stuff about his magical powers and a sakura tree, but basically the goal is to make it with one of the female heroines, one of which happens to be his cousin. Probably unhealthy, I know, right?

Anyways, there haven't been any new details regarding the plot of the upcoming season, but with the original game starting to see some circulation here in America, one might wonder if someone will be ballsy enough to pick up the license. I'd say it's slightly more likely than it was before, but still incredibly unlikely. I could always be wrong, though.
